Transaction 837a7256f267a182ab3a6b57e1af064e7729b23947195dd86756297a77277999
1 Input
1 Output
-
837a7256f267a182ab3a6b57e1af064e7729b23947195dd86756297a77277999:0
- value
- 2502043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b8f857249ac97d76e56e6105f129e0f20f3b486 OP_EQUAL
- address
- 3BVkA6uVSoGynJiAbCTRBBHwrF6Nipkfjn